Job description

Our Southeast Region Architecture Group is seeking a candidate with the desire to use and grow their technical expertise to successfully deliver projects across a variety of markets and building types, with potential to support architecture work across Water, Resource, Federal, and Building Engineering market sectors. In this role, you’ll partner with project managers to lead the planning, design, documentation, and construction administration of multiple building types, from high-performance data centers that power cloud computing and the digital infrastructure the world relies on, to water treatment facilities that provide clean drinking water for entire communities, to advanced manufacturing plants, office spaces, operations centers, and maintenance facilities, among other project types.

Location preference: Charlotte, NC; Raleigh, NC; or Atlanta, GA.

Responsibilities
  • Be knowledgeable in technical design concepts, code applications, design management skills, digital technologies, and design workflows for industrial-type facilities.
  • Lead owner/client and internal meetings and participate in reviews with various governing agencies for code compliance.
  • Lead project teams with varied levels of experience to successfully complete and deliver construction documents and intermediate milestone deliverables.
  • Work with the Project Manager to proactively manage scope and schedule.
  • Manage and undertake design activities and the production of detailed documents required for construction.
  • Independently coordinate the work of a multidisciplinary team through all phases of a project.
  • Review architectural documents for areas of conflict with all disciplines.
  • Perform QA/QC and cross discipline technical reviews.
  • Write and edit architectural specifications.
  • Coordinate with and assist affected disciplines with addenda, RFIs, CPRs and change orders.
  • Incorporate agreed-upon changes into project documents.
  • Provide construction observation and contract administration as needed.
  • Conduct work sessions at project site in conjunction with Client Representatives, Project Managers and other disciplines.
  • Perform other duties as needed.
